Ecological protection efforts have undergone major change of late. Current conservation plans direct their energies on thorough ecosystem control instead of specific species safeguard. This all-encompassing approach is leading to significant outcomes in diversity preservation throughout multiple habitats.
Ecological sustainability emerged as the core of new-age conservation thought, with initiatives formed by organizations like the Sheldrick Wildlife Trust, progressively focused on preserving the natural processes that sustain thriving communities rather than solely safeguarding individual species in separation. This approach realizes that sustainable preservation relies on upholding the complex network of connections uniting predators and targets, pollinators and vegetation, and the range of life forms that facilitate resource cycling and habitat maintenance. Present-day sustainability efforts frequently involve rehabilitation of eroded habitats, reintroduction of pivotal fauna and oversight of human actions influencing ecosystem functionality. Such programs generally demand long-term commitments covering multiple years and involve persistent monitoring to evaluate the success of interventions, adapting plans as circumstances shift. The assimilation of climate change considerations into sustainability strategy introduced an additional layer of difficulty, requiring environmentalists to forecast how varying environmental present conditions may influence life forms distributions and habitat dynamics. Effective ecological sustainability projects typically are viewed as models for comparable endeavors in various geographic areas, helping to an expanding wealth of knowledge about efficient habitat management tactics.
Wildlife rehabilitation centres embody perhaps the most noticeable and immediately impactful facet of new-age preservation actions, functioning as indispensable facilities where wounded, orphaned, or misplaced animals get customized care prior to being reinstated to their natural habitats. These centers transformed from basic holding places into innovative medical and focused on behavior treatment centers staffed by vets, animal behaviorists, and skilled technicians that specialize in the distinct needs of various species. The rehabilitation process typically engages a range of stages, beginning with urgent medical care and advancing through physical therapy, behavioral, and pre-discharge preparations crafted to increase the likelihood of successful reintegration within wild populations. Modern rehabilitation centers carry extensive medical logs and follow-up oversight data that add valuable knowledge to conservation research and assist improve therapy processes. Many centers additionally serve key informative roles, providing opportunities for community engagement and expert development that support broader backing for preservation efforts. Wildlife conservation has experienced a significant transformation in recent decades, with present-day initiatives adopting progressively sophisticated methods for protecting threatened species. Traditional approaches of merely establishing secured regions had developed into detailed strategies that deal with the complex interconnections among plant and animal life, habitats, and human communities. These modern conservation initiatives acknowledge that successful safeguards require comprehending the detailed connections within ecological communities and the diverse factors that endanger biodiversity. Study institutions and conservation organizations are now implementing multidisciplinary methods that integrate domain biology, heredity, technology, and social sciences to create even more efficient security tactics. The combining of satellite tracking, DNA analysis, and artificial intelligence had revolutionized how preservationists track populations, assess risks, and execute protective measures. Furthermore, these present-day preservation efforts more and more emphasize the importance of involving local communities as collaborators instead of obstacles, acknowledging that lasting safeguard necessitates the support and participation of people who share habitats with endangered species.
Animal rescue operations by organizations such as Bornfree had progressed from basic urgent actions to advanced, science-focused initiatives that deal with both immediate risks and sustained community stability. Current rescue efforts utilize veterinary professionals, behavioural experts, and conservation biologists that work together to confirm treatment plans both animal welfare and wider conservation goals. These missions often entail . complex logistics, such as rapid response units ready with specialized transport facilities, mobile animal care units, and temporary housing solutions designed to minimize stress on saved animals. The success of modern-day rescue programs massively depends on well-constructed protocols that were developed through research and experience. Training initiatives for recovery personnel include modules on species-specific behavior, tension management methods, and post-recovery supervision procedures. Furthermore, numerous operations maintain extensive databases that follow distinct creatures throughout their healing journey, providing critical insights for future rescue strategies and contributing to enhanced grasping of life sciences and action cues.
